Area Facility Operations Specialist Salary in the United States

How much does an Area Facility Operations Specialist make in the United States?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for an Area Facility Operations Specialist in the United States is $48,062 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$23.

However, an Area Facility Operations Specialist's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$55,866
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$44,069 to $52,147
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$40,434

How Do Area Facility Operations Specialist Salaries Vary from State to State?

Your salary can change significantly depending on where you work. States with a higher cost of living and strong industrial sectors often pay more to attract Area Facility Operations Specialists. For example, consider the average annual salaries in these key locations:

  • District of Columbia: $53,214.
  • California: $53,012.
  • Massachusetts: $52,306.

Top Paying Cities for Area Facility Operations Specialists

Salaries can also vary between different cities. Major metropolitan areas or cities with a high demand for technicians often offer more competitive pay. Here are a few examples of average annual salaries in different U.S. cities:

  • San Jose: $60,620
  • San Francisco: $59,957
  • Oakland: $58,693

Area Facility Operations Specialist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Area Facility Operations Specialist ro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 50%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Financial Services and Insurance s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 30% above the average. In contrast, Area Facility Operations Specialist positions in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it or Retail & Wholesale typ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Area Facility Operations Specialist as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
